I don't want to pee on the fire here, but I wasn't really too impressed by the demo. In other threads I think someone hit the nail on the head when they said that Yamaha's styles are (TOO PERFECT). I think that's what make them sound exactly like they were done on a arranger keyboard. They don't feel and sound "real".
They seem to lack "naturalism". I think that's why I feel something like Ketron has much better quality styles. Those styles just have that "natural" feel and groove to them. Korgs are close to that as well.
Yamaha's are just too perfect (if that makes sense). I think the Tyros 1 and 2 has some good sounds, but I think Yamaha has really lost the WOW factor in the style department. I think their styles drip with cheezy (I know some will disagree).
Maybe they're just over quantized, and that takes away from the natural feel.
